Who is Mark Manders?

Mark Manders is a Dutch artist. He was born in 1968 in Volkel, Netherlands. At first, he studied graphic design until age eighteen. He changed his mind and decided to be a writer but with objects instead of words. He became very interested in the paralleled evolution of humans and objects. Manders's body of work consists mainly of installations, drawings, sculptures and short films. Typical of his work is the arrangement of random objects, such as tables, chairs, light bulbs, blankets and dead animals. He is best known for his rough-hewn clay sculptures. Manders is represented by Tanya Bonakdar Gallery in New York.
